I for one have no problem with the ARG label or the hanging out with
video game folks. Videogames are more and more interested in narrative
these days, and I think the "gamey" parts of ARGs improve the player
experience.

And when I tell videogame devs that I also do ARGs they no longer
stare blankly at me and think I just choked on something.

I plan to continue to embrace it and love it and call it george.
